Preparing for the HQ/A
The personal Health Questionnaire/Health Assessment (HQ/A) asks for your basic biometric information (height, weight, blood pressure) and the results from a basic blood test (cholesterol and glucose levels). This information is a critical input for the questionnaire. However, we recognize that many faculty and staff members don’t know their personal biometric “numbers.” To help you get this information, most of the institutions participating in HEALTHY YOU will hold a series of “Know Your Numbers” biometric screenings around their campuses. Or, you can get the information from your doctor if you’ve had a physical exam recently, or plan to have one in the near future.
Be sure to have the information on hand when you complete your questionnaire.
